Lukaku ‘more mature’ on Chelsea return

- By Jason Burt

Chelsea have confirmed the signing of Romelu Lukaku for a club record £97.5 million in a five-year deal.

The 28-year-old striker is not expected to be in the squad for their opening Premier League fixture at home to Crystal Palace tomorrow.

In their announceme­nt, Chelsea spoke of Lukaku having “unfinished business”.

According to the Premier League website, the striker has taken the No18 shirt – the number he was awarded during his previous spell at the club, which ended with him frustrated and demanding a move.

There had been an expectatio­n that Lukaku would take the No9, but Tammy Abraham is yet to agree an exit from Chelsea despite Roma pushing for a deal to be struck, having met the £34million asking price, albeit initially through a loan move.

“It’s been a long journey for me: I came here as a kid who had a lot to learn, now I’m coming back with a lot of experience and more mature,” Lukaku said.

“The relationsh­ip I have with the club means so much to me, as you know. I have supported Chelsea as a kid, and now to be back and to try to help them win more titles is an amazing feeling.”

Meanwhile, Chelsea seasontick­et holders face missing out on the Palace game because of delays in installing rail seating at Stamford Bridge. The club have been working around the clock to complete the work and will announce this afternoon whether the ground will be at full capacity against Palace.

But they warned yesterday that some spectators could miss out, particular­ly those in the Matthew Harding Lower Stand in blocks 8, 9, 14, 15 and 16 and are promising to compensate those affected.

A club statement said: “We sincerely apologise for this situation, we should have done better.”
